Dimplex is ‘going up in the world' as the number one choice for low carbon heating and hot water with the addition of integrated roof kits to its solar thermal hot water system.
As a leading player in the provision of low carbon electric heating solutions, including heat pumps and easy-to-integrate all electric systems, the new Dimplex solar kits have been designed to allow optimum flexibility and speed of installation.
Roof integrated solar is the popular choice in many new build installations and the unique design of the new Dimplex integrated roof mounting kit makes installation quick and easy by providing the weatherproofing integrity of the roof structure without the need for the collector to be installed at the same time. This means that the collector itself can be installed once the roof covering has been applied, making scheduling of the build programme much easier by allowing roofing and plumbing trades to work autonomously.
Available for either slate or tile roof coverings, the Dimplex kits use the same connection fittings as standard roof fixing kits and allow for two, four and six square metre installations, across single, two and three panels.
